  • Title

    Dual-Frequency Ytterbium-Doped Fiber Laser

  • Abstract
    A dual-frequency, 2-cm silica fiber laser with two orthogonal polarizations has been demonstrated. Single-mode operation at each wavelength has been verified. The OSNR is greater than 60 dB with an output power of 43 mW
